Is there a workaround for bad food? It seems so senseless that bad food can’t be automatically destroyed or at least put somewhere else (I haven’t noticed a category for bad food in the inventory slots so I can direct Hearthlings to move the bad food somewhere when it goes bad).
@wog_gie: In theory rotten food disappears after a while anyway. In practice, it’s buggy and if you remove the stockpile you get stuck with rotten food forever (or until you use the console to “destroy”).

I’m pretty sure you can use even the destroy/clear items tool in the harvest tab to get rotten food - in a stockpile or just on the ground - queued to be destroyed by your Hearthlings without having to use the console. It’s still painfully manual, though.
